The overview below groups typical Exit Window Installation proj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Muncie, IN.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- for minor adjustments or replacing a single window, local contractors typically charge between $250 and $600. Many routine jobs fall within this range, depending on the window size and materials used.
Standard Replacement - replacing an entire exit window with a standard model usually costs between $600 and $1,200. This range covers most typical installations in residential properties in the Muncie area.
Larger, Complex Projects - projects involving custom sizes, additional structural work, or multiple windows can range from $1,200 to $3,500 or more. Fewer projects reach into this higher tier, but costs can vary based on specific requirements.
Full Window System Installations - complete overhaul including framing, insulation, and finishing may cost $3,500 to $5,000+ for larger or more intricate setups. These projects are less common but are handled by local pros for custom or commercial needs.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
